The German word "Trumps" is not standard; it likely refers to the English word "trumps." In German, "Trumpf" means a decisive advantage or the suit of cards that outranks others in a game.
In this sentence, 'Trumpf' refers to a winning card or suit in a card game.
In einem Kartenspiel hat er mit einem Trumpf gewonnen.
In a card game, he won with a trump.
In this example, 'Trümpfe' is metaphorically used to denote advantages or key strengths.
In einer Diskussion sind überzeugende Argumente die Trümpfe.
In a discussion, convincing arguments are the trumps.
